Product name: HP 250 15.6 inch G10 Notebook PC
Issue: TouchPad missing
It's been missing since the beginning, I can't see any Internal Pointing Devices from the BIOS setup to enable and I installed Windows using an external mouse (the USB receiver works fine).
I cannot enable it from Settings as it doesn't appear.
Funny enough it allows me to enable the Touchpad icon on the taskbar, which I did but it doesn't respond when I click on it.
I went into Device Manager + compared it with my other HP G5 and noticed:
Synaptics HID Device driver is missing from Human Interface Devices
Synaptics HID ClickPad is missing under Mice and other pointing devices.
However, all my drivers are up to date + I tried to uninstall all of those and restart + I checked on hidden drivers too. Please help!
